Alex-followed the link ref house prices. Most interesting is average price 1998 around the 65k mark. Average now around £165k.
Given that lending in 1998 was relatively sensible (3x salary etc) then the 1998 prices were reasonable. Taking the 3x salary as a guide (worked fine in the 'old days') then average salary needs to be around 55k, which is definitely not the case in the UK. Add in job losses and I think house prices generally will continue to fall. Much of consumer spending was based on the 'feel good' factor of their house value going up.
